#b3112d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3112d is composed of 70.2% red, 6.7%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.5% magenta, 74.9%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 349.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 38.4%. #b3112d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ff225a with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#b3112d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3112d has RGB values of R:179, G:17,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.75,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11735341.

Shades and Tints of #b3112d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120204 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b3112d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#685c5e is the less saturated color, while #c20223 is the most saturated one.
